4. Last Year (F1Q26): Organic sales fell 4.2% (-4.8% shipments; -2.6% depletions) as Hispanic

consumer headwinds kicked in. Elevated ad spend on a weaker core consumer led to an EPS

shortfall of $3.22 (vs $3.36). The full-year outlook was maintained until Sept '25 when Constellation

cut its F26 EPS guide by 10% as immigration-fueled concerns peaked.

5. Estimate Revisions: We lower our F1Q organic sales growth estimate to 1% (in-line) on the

trajectory of US consumption trends. Down the P&L, we reduce our EBIT margins by 80bp to better

account for elevated ad spend. This reduces our F1Q EPS estimate to $3.21 (Street $3.24). For F27,

we expect 0.8% organic sales growth and lower GM expansion (46bp) than we initially expected.

This puts us at $11.70 (Street $11.79; prior $11.73).

6. Investment Thesis: Constellation's beer portfolio is no longer delivering run-rate growth in the

MSD-HSD% range. Being landlocked in a challenged US beverage alcohol market makes it difficult

to justify shares returning to 18x P/E (10Y historical average), in the absence of improvement in

its core consumer.

7. Valuation: To expand the multiple, we believe there needs to be proof that the company can

regain momentum in F27 and beyond. PT to $157 based on 10.5x our F28 Adj. EBITDA of $3.6bn.
